version 1.56, 2004/07/28 21:01:38
|
version 1.60, 2004/08/12 12:41:11
|
|
|
| |
ifdef PEGASUS_CIM_SCHEMA | ifdef PEGASUS_CIM_SCHEMA |
CIM_SCHEMA_DIR=$(PEGASUS_ROOT)/Schemas/$(PEGASUS_CIM_SCHEMA) | CIM_SCHEMA_DIR=$(PEGASUS_ROOT)/Schemas/$(PEGASUS_CIM_SCHEMA) |
|
ifeq ($(findstring $(patsubst CIM%,%,$(patsubst CIMPrelim%,%,$(PEGASUS_CIM_SCHEMA))),1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 271 28),) |
|
CIM_SCHEMA_VER= |
|
else |
CIM_SCHEMA_VER=$(patsubst CIM%,%,$(patsubst CIMPrelim%,%,$(PEGASUS_CIM_SCHEMA))) | CIM_SCHEMA_VER=$(patsubst CIM%,%,$(patsubst CIMPrelim%,%,$(PEGASUS_CIM_SCHEMA))) |
|
endif |
else | else |
CIM_SCHEMA_DIR=$(PEGASUS_ROOT)/Schemas/CIM28 | CIM_SCHEMA_DIR=$(PEGASUS_ROOT)/Schemas/CIM28 |
CIM_SCHEMA_VER=28 | CIM_SCHEMA_VER=28 |
|
|
DEFINES+= -DPEGASUS_ENABLE_SLP | DEFINES+= -DPEGASUS_ENABLE_SLP |
endif | endif |
| |
|
# set PEGASUS_DEBUG into the DEFINES if it exists. |
|
# Note that this flag is the general separator between |
|
# debug compiles and non-debug compiles and controls both |
|
# the use of any debug options on compilers and linkers |
|
# and general debug support that we want to be turned on in |
|
# debug mode. |
|
ifdef PEGASUS_DEBUG |
|
DEFINES+= -DPEGASUS_DEBUG |
|
endif |
|
|
# compile in the experimental APIs | # compile in the experimental APIs |
DEFINES+= -DPEGASUS_USE_EXPERIMENTAL_INTERFACES | DEFINES+= -DPEGASUS_USE_EXPERIMENTAL_INTERFACES |
| |
|
# Set compile flag to control compilation of CIMOM statistics |
|
ifdef PEGASUS_HAS_PERFINST |
|
FLAGS += -DPEGASUS_HAS_PERFINST |
|
endif |
| |
############################################################ | ############################################################ |
# | # |